Transaction 95a21db0bbddcda96c41b264da2e80c9723309dcda4e1034f4538be9ded1aa9c
1 Input
1 Output
-
95a21db0bbddcda96c41b264da2e80c9723309dcda4e1034f4538be9ded1aa9c:0
- value
- 3975447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a93156be382f30f4a4a3476ffbd3f9934747f1b OP_EQUAL
- address
- 3FnLBdzt34JzQs54dqsvr4crhxBk2i6eC6